Job Summary: We are seeking a Director's Assistant to support multiple filmmakers working on unannounced animated CG feature films. Reporting to the Director of Development Production, the Director's Assistant will manage the day-to-day needs of the Directors and Producers on these films in development and support their production needs on an as-needed basis. What You’ll Do: - Maintain calendars for Directors and Producers in Development, scheduling and coordinating meetings at their request - Coordinate travel as needed - Create and process expense reports as needed - Generate and distribute production documents and scripts as needed, including printouts or photocopies - Assist with preparing conference rooms for creative reviews, organizing and gathering physical materials as needed - Provide coverage of meetings by taking detailed notes, for the benefit of the Director/Producer. - Elevate any concerns on the Producer or Director's well-being or scheduling to NAS Development Executives - Ensure that Producer and Director have the materials needed to complete their work - Collaborate with grace, humility, inclusion, and open-mindedness - Other duties as assigned by the Producer and Director What You’ll Need: - 1+ years experience preferred as a Producer's Assistant, Production Assistant, internship experience in animation production, or related experience - Knowledge of CG animation processes preferred - Organized, detail-oriented, ability to multitask, strong desire to learn, interested in people, and have excellent verbal, written, and e-social communication skills - Comfort level working in a fast-paced, constantly evolving environment with the ability to manage time and balance priorities - Experienced in Google Suite (preferred) and/or Microsoft Office - Knowledge of asset and shot tracking systems, preferably ShotGrid, a plus - Familiarity of Photoshop, Adobe Suite, and Final Draft a plus - Proactive, positive thinker with a willingness to offer assistance with any task large or small, to contribute to a well-functioning and motivated team Location: This role is based out of the Burbank office. The University of Iowa Office of Admissions is hiring a dedicated Assistant Director, California Regional Representative. (100%25 appointment) The California Regional Representative will be responsible for managing admissions, recruitment, and outreach activities in the West Coast region for the University of Iowa. Primary travel responsibilities will be in California, Arizona, Oregon, and Washington with additional travel possible to meet recruiting needs. Working closely with senior admission team members, this position plans and executes strategies to meet enrollment goals while serving prospective students through the college search process. The required remote location for this position is in Los Angeles County or Orange County California. They will also have the opportunity to: - Build relationships with prospective students and families, high school counselors, community-based organization leaders, independent college counselors and others involved in the college search process while also cultivating an active network of local alumni to leverage in recruitment activities - Utilize data tools to actively monitor territory analytics, provide reports and activity updates, and recommend appropriate strategies and tactics to achieve enrollment goals. - Participate in Regional Admissions Counselors of California (RACC), Regional ACAC’s, and Big Ten Academic Alliance organizations. - Assist in the planning and execution of student transition programs as needed. - And more! Technical Director – Drinking Water Treatment We are seeking a skilled, experienced Technical Director to join our Operations and Maintenance Services team supporting a diverse array of treatment facilities across the US.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in water treatment, with a proven track record of providing operational and regulatory compliance expertise to drinking water treatment facilities. This role is critical to helping to ensure the stability, efficiency, and compliance of water treatment systems under our care. The position is location independent with an average expectation of 50% travel (typically 8-10 nights/month). RESPONSIBILITIES: - Technical Expertise: Provide expert guidance across our portfolio of facilities on the operation of water treatment plants, including troubleshooting, process control and optimization, and regulatory compliance. - Stakeholder Collaboration: Work closely with facility-based operational staff, regulatory agencies, company leadership and other stakeholders to ensure alignment with plant performance goals and regulatory requirements. - Quality Assurance: Support the company’s QA programs to ensure the highest standards of service delivery and compliance with all relevant regulations. - Innovation and Improvement: Drive continuous improvement initiatives to en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of operations and maintenance activities. QUALIFICATIONS: - Minimum of Bachelor’s degree in a STEM related field required. Course work in data science/statistical methods is a plus. - Minimum of 10 years of experience in water treatment operations, treatment process troubleshooting and/or regulatory roles. Plant supervisory experience and/or operational licensure is a plus. - Strong knowledge of SDWA requirements and industry standards for water treatment facility performance. - Experience in project or initiative management, including planning, execution, budgeting or costing, and stakeholder management. - Excellent leadership, communication, and interpersonal skills. - Ability to work collaboratively with diverse teams and stakeholders.
